Cabinet to approve new funding pattern for centrally sponsored schemes: Sources-Funding pattern for centrally sponsored schemes to be 50:50 between centre & states-New funding pattern to apply for all centrally sponsored schemes across states-New funding pattern needed with 42 percent of central taxes being devolved to states-Currently there is no fixed pattern for centrally sponsored schemes-Centre's share in centrally sponsored schemes funding ranged between 25 percent to 75 percent across schemes & states
Cabinet-Approves automatic FDI into real estate investment trusts (REITs)-Approves change in FEMA norms to allow inflow of foreign investment into real estate investment trusts-Approves proposal to raise FIPB's investment approval cap-Approves raising FIPB approval limit to investments worth Rs 3000 crore from Rs 1,200 crore-Approves cabinet approves Amendment Of Whistleblowers Protection Act 2011-Rajya Sabha clears Constitution amendment bill to enable the ratification of land boundary agreement with Bangladesh
